The drug loading and release procedures were optimized in sequential injection analysis (SIA) systems obtaining a huge economy regarding the time spent (4 min towards 2 h). Batch and SIA methods were tested and compared for the different behaviours of the PSi nanoparticles towards both methodologies and no noteworthy differences were obtained with Student's t-test for loading with a calculated t value of 2.04 showing the absence of statistical differences. All the results present a RSD less than 10%. So, the developed automatic methodologies are a viable alternative to load drugs and to study the release profiles from PSi nanoparticles.
